Of course, the very first step to realising how to host a summer party is to work out the logistics. Although it may be tempting to rush straight into the food and entertainment, you should always start the planning process by choosing a date and time that works for the majority of the guest checklist. Whether you're having a large party or an intimate gathering, make sure to leave plenty of notification for people to put the party date into their calendars. After all, summer is frequently the busiest time of year for families due to the fact that schools have broken up. To guarantee that a great deal of individuals are available, send out the invites a number of months ahead of time. Additionally, as soon as you have set the date and have a concept on the guest numbers, you can then move onto the much more exciting and enjoyable part of the party planning procedure, like picking summer party themes, games and entertainment etc.
When organising a summer party for adults, it is extremely easy to become stressed out and overwhelmed. However, there is an easy way to overcome this; proper preparation. Leave yourself plenty of time to arrange every little thing and write a comprehensive check-list of all the things that need to be done. Near the top of the list ought to be the party catering. One of the best summer party food ideas is to stick to a buffet-style spread. Not only does it make life much easier for you as the host, however it implies that attendees feel no pressure to eat at a certain time. Rather, they can help themselves to some scrumptious finger food whenever they want, while chatting get more info to the various other guests or grooving along to the music.
